In 2020-2021, 2,335 people earned their degree in other teacher education and professional development, specific subject areas, making the major the 285th most popular in the United States.

Across New Hampshire, there were 2 other teacher education and professional development, specific subject areas gra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 1 other teacher education and professional development, specific subject areas graduates with average earnings and debt of $57,663 and $0 respectively.
